How do I change author details in WordPress?

Changing the Author to Another User in Block Editor

  1. Click “Posts” and then “All Posts”
  2. Choose the post you want to change the author of and click “Edit”
  3. Click “Document” in the right sidebar.
  4. Find “Author” under “Status and Visibility”
  5. Open the dropdown menu to change the author.
  6. Click “Update” to confirm the change.

How do I create an author profile in WordPress?

Adding a new user to your WordPress website

  1. Log in to WordPress (yourdomain.com/wp-admin).
  2. Click Users > Add New.
  3. Enter a Username (required).
  4. Enter an Email (required).
  5. Select the Role for the new user.
  6. Click Add New User.
